Key Features to Look For
When you’re picking out garden beds, pay attention to these important things:
- Width: This is how wide the bed is. You want it to be easy to reach the middle from either side. A common width is 3-4 feet. This lets you reach without stepping into the bed. Stepping in can pack the soil too tightly.
- Length: This is how long the bed is. It can be as long as you want! However, consider how much space you have. Also, think about how much you can reach from the ends.
- Height: This is how tall the bed is. Taller beds are easier to work in. They also help with drainage. You won’t have to bend over as much. A height of 8-12 inches is good for most plants. Taller beds, 18-24 inches, are great for deep-rooted vegetables or if you have trouble bending.
- Accessibility: Can you get to all parts of the bed easily? Think about pathways between beds. You need enough room to walk and use tools.
Important Materials
Garden beds come in many materials. Each has its pros and cons:
- Wood: This is a popular choice. Cedar and redwood are good because they resist rot and insects. Pine is cheaper but won’t last as long unless treated. Make sure any treated wood is safe for growing food.
- Metal: Steel and aluminum are strong and last a long time. They can get hot in the sun, which might affect plant roots. Raised metal beds often have a coating to protect them.
- Composite: This material is made from recycled plastic and wood fibers. It’s durable and won’t rot. It’s a good option if you want something low-maintenance.
- Stone or Brick: These look beautiful and last forever. They can be more expensive and harder to build.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
The way a garden bed is built affects its quality.
- Sturdy Construction: The bed should be strong. It needs to hold a lot of soil. If the sides bow out, it means it’s not built well. Look for beds with good corner joints.
- Drainage: Good drainage is key. If water sits in the bed, your plants can get root rot. Taller beds naturally drain better. Make sure the bottom isn’t blocked.
- Material Durability: Some materials last longer than others. Wood will eventually rot. Metal can rust if not protected. Choose a material that fits your budget and how long you want the bed to last.
- Ease of Assembly: If you buy a kit, how easy is it to put together? Some kits have simple instructions and require few tools. Others can be complicated.
User Experience and Use Cases
Think about how you will use your garden beds.
- Beginners: Start with a simple, manageable size. A 4×8 foot bed is a good starting point. It’s easy to reach everything.
- Small Spaces: If you have a small yard or balcony, consider smaller, modular beds. You can arrange them to fit your space. Vertical garden beds are also great for tiny areas.
- Large Gardens: If you have lots of space, you can build longer beds. Just make sure you can still reach the middle. Consider adding pathways so you don’t compact the soil.
- Accessibility Needs: If you have trouble bending or kneeling, choose taller beds. This makes gardening much more comfortable. You can even add a bench around a very tall bed.
Frequently Asked Questions About Garden Bed Sizes
Q: What is the most common size for a raised garden bed?
A: The most common size is 4 feet wide and 8 feet long. This size allows you to reach the center from either side without stepping into the bed.
Q: How wide should my garden beds be?
A: Most gardeners find that a width of 3 to 4 feet is ideal. This lets you easily reach the middle of the bed.
Q: Does the length of a garden bed matter as much as the width?
A: The length is more flexible. You can make it as long as your space allows. Just make sure you can still reach the middle from the ends.
Q: How tall should a raised garden bed be?
A: For most plants, a height of 8 to 12 inches is good. Taller beds, 18 to 24 inches, are better for deep-rooted vegetables or if you want to reduce bending.
Q: What if I have a very small yard?
A: You can use smaller beds, like 3×6 feet, or even square beds that are 3×3 feet. Look into vertical garden beds too; they save a lot of ground space.
Q: Can I make my garden beds too long?
A: Yes, if a bed is too long, it can be hard to reach the middle. Try to keep the length manageable for your reach.
Q: Should I worry about the material of my garden bed?
A: Yes, different materials last longer and are better for certain uses. Wood, metal, and composite are common choices.
Q: How do I ensure good drainage in my garden beds?
A: Taller beds naturally drain better. Also, make sure the soil you use is loose and drains well. Avoid materials that block water flow at the bottom.
